(USA) Shipping and Receiving Coordinator, Central Fill, Health and Wellness Central Operations - Health and Wellness
Position Summary
Maintains sorter operation by removing full totes from the sorter tote location, replenishing empty totes at the sorter locations, scanning tote and location with a handheld scanner, and rearranging individual units in totes to ensure proper fill rates.
Manages product deliveries by preparing, reviewing, and verifying receiving documentation and reports, processing counts, separates and scans product, operates computer software and basic applications to track and identify product, unloads product from trailer manually or with powered equipment, organizes inventory and transfers them to production stations, maintains records, logs, and forms for example shipping manifests.
Stocks drugs by using box cutters and knives to open boxes without damaging contents, monitors product size and makes adjustments when product is too large or small, labels, scans and sorts drug types to ensure they are in the right location, transports drugs and places them in their designated locations, stores excess drugs on the overstock shelves or racks, and drives forklift to transport skid items in the pharmacy.
Maintains quality accuracy and integrity of inventory and packages by removing damaged or expired product, identifying and resolving discrepancies in records or files, informing management about incorrect or inefficient processes and improper service procedures, and providing basic maintenance to equipment for example, cleaning, changing labels, bags, ribbons.
Completes work assignments and priorities by using policies, data, and resources, collaborating with managers, coworkers, customers, and other business partners, identifying priorities, deadlines, and expectations, carrying out tasks, communicating progress and information, determining and recommending ways to address improvement opportunities, and adapting to and learning from change, difficulties, and feedback.
Ensures accurate packing and shipping of pharmacy products by packing prescriptions, scanning the leaflet and medication, placing the package on a conveyor to deliver it to the sorter, packing temperature sensitive medication according to drug specifications, ensuring needed supplies are included in each shipment, stocking workstations with needed supplies for packing and processing shipments, processing and labeling shipments using approved carrier software and equipment, and completing and verifying paperwork for pickup and delivery of shipments.
